【今日/总数】文章:0/2773 用户:0/10774 书籍:0/200
回顾2016,喜迎2017,以“回顾我与C++技术网的2016,展望C++技术网的2017”为主题,发表文章,将有机会赢得2个月的会员或现金红包。

原创版权标志Linux编程GCC编译简单快速入门:编译代码

作者:codexia  发表时间:2017/1/11 11:24:35  阅读:70
[摘要]虽然GCC开起来很强大,实际上在使用的时候,也可以很方便的。我们来看看GCC如何快速方便的编译程序。
文章来源:C++技术网 原创文章版权所有,未经授权,禁止转载。
    在Windows中,我们利用Visual Studio强大的集成环境,只要点击一个编译按钮,就可以轻松编译。然而,在得到便利的同时,我们失去了对编译本身细节的了解。不过在Linux编程时,需要我们对此有一定的了解,否则连程序都编译不出来。
    虽然GCC开起来很强大,实际上在使用的时候,也可以很方便的。我们来看看GCC如何快速方便的编译程序。

    我们的代码如下:
//cjjjs.c
#include 

void main()
{
    printf("hello www.cjjjs.com\n");
}

1.直接默认设置编译
gcc cjjjs.c
    编译的结果:a.out
    a.out是默认的编译链接生成的可执行程序文件。可能你感觉这个名字比较怪异,而且是默认的a.out,所以你想指定一下生成的程序文件名。

2.指定生成可执行程序的文件名,使用gcc的-o命令选项
gcc cjjjs.c -o www.cjjjs.com
    编译的结果:www....【登录后阅读更多内容】
文章来源:C++技术网 原创文章版权所有,未经授权,禁止转载。



返回顶部

关于我们 QQ群 广告服务 增值服务 捐款资助 版权声明 RSS订阅 站点地图 百度网站地图 意见反馈
鄂ICP备14001349号-2, Copyright © 2014-2017, CJJJS.COM/CJJJS.CN, All Rights Reserved

在线提问
问题标题:
问题描述:(简陋的描述会导致问题被最后回答、没有针对性回答甚至无法解答。请确保问题描述的足够清楚。)